开发者社区> 问答> 正文

hbase开发方向

已解决

做大数据开发三年多,接触与使用的技术很多(都是使用与原理层面,不涉及源码的开发),比较深入底层的还是>hbase的开发(进行过简单二次开发),

试问一下,假如以后做大数据方向hbase开发的话,需要哪些软技能与硬技能呢?需要指点一下,有点迷茫,不知道持续做HBASE开发(hbase底层源码开发为主)还是继续大数据方向业务开发(各大技术都要用到)?

展开
收起
sunt_dota 2018-01-30 10:42:14 3653 0
6 条回答
写回答
取消 提交回答
  • 采纳回答

    HBASE开发不难,你不能局限在一门存储产品上,不然就业面受限严重,除非你的HBase水平努力达到专家水平。
    建议往大数据实时计算方向,把相关流程都提升到你目前认为还在行的HBase水准。
    硬件技能很简单,相关大数据产品的基础运维命令要熟悉,软件技能当然要学会多一些的大数据产品,至少能自己部署出来一整套高可用的运行环境,单单只会HBase的话,你的就业面就很窄了,毕竟现在用HBase的公司并不算特别多,尤其是涉及到算法这一块(越来越流行),HBase有它的局限性,这个时候更多的是用到KV or KKV等结构化存储产品。另外,大公司未来用SPARK也会越来越少,很多都是定制化开发的产品。

    2019-07-17 21:57:07
    赞同 2 展开评论 打赏
  • 个人对建模比较关注

    大数据,则要有数据,数据的采集,数据采集了要存,则数据的存储,数据到手了,让数据产生价值,则数据分析,数据分析出结果了,则要给相关人员查看使用,则数据可视化,数据涉及方方面面,每个环节都有很多子环节

    2019-07-17 21:57:07
    赞同 展开评论 打赏
  • Yui

    继续大数据方向业务开发吧

    2019-07-17 21:57:07
    赞同 1 展开评论 打赏
  • 其实很多大数据工具都是相同的,最基础的先把hadoop和hdfs数量掌握下;hbase,es等工具熟悉了一种原理,其他的也就都差不多了

    2019-07-17 21:57:07
    赞同 1 展开评论 打赏
  • 大数据不仅仅hbase,可以了解的东西很多,建议体系化的学习

    2019-07-17 21:57:07
    赞同 1 展开评论 打赏
  • 个人感觉不仅仅是hbase, 把hadoop整体生态圈技术吃透的话,还是不容易的

    2019-07-17 21:57:07
    赞同 1 展开评论 打赏
滑动查看更多
问答排行榜
最热
最新

相关电子书

更多
大数据时代的存储 ——HBase的实践与探索 立即下载
Hbase在滴滴出行的应用场景和最佳实践 立即下载
阿里云HBase主备双活 立即下载